Closed Bug 1021500 Opened 11 years ago Closed 11 years ago

[Keyboard] Keyboard for Email shouldn't have '_' in the second row

Categories

(Firefox OS Graveyard :: Gaia::Keyboard, defect, P1)

ARM
Gonk (Firefox OS)
defect

Tracking

(b2g-v2.1 verified)

VERIFIED FIXED
Tracking Status
b2g-v2.1 --- verified

People

(Reporter: Omega, Assigned: raniere)

References

Details

(Whiteboard: [2.0-FL-bug-bash])

Attachments

(2 files)

Device: Flame Gaia: 2014-06-05 23:34:17 BuildID: 20140602160205 Version: 2.0.0.0-prerelease STR: 1) Tap any "email" input to show keyboard Actual: There is '_' key in the second row Expected: There shouldn't be '_' key in the second row
Whiteboard: [2.0-FL-bug-bash]
Based on? Is there a UI document that says this should be removed?
Flags: needinfo?(ofeng)
(In reply to Jan Jongboom [:janjongboom] (Telenor) from comment #1) > Based on? Is there a UI document that says this should be removed? Hi Jan, There is no UI spec that says '_' should be there, so we should remove it to keep the layouts (normal text and email) consistent.
Flags: needinfo?(ofeng)
Attachment #8435773 - Flags: ui-review?(ofeng)
Attachment #8435773 - Flags: review?(janjongboom)
Comment on attachment 8435773 [details] [review] patch-remove-extra-keys-from-second-row Good job! Thanks!
Attachment #8435773 - Flags: ui-review?(ofeng) → ui-review+
Comment on attachment 8435773 [details] [review] patch-remove-extra-keys-from-second-row Clearing review for now. This only solves it for English but all other layouts have the same configuration. We should fix it for all layouts.
Attachment #8435773 - Flags: review?(janjongboom)
Some questions, although they are very similar. 1. For Spanish, the second row for email and url should have "ñ"? 2. For Catalan, Croatian, Hungarian and Serbian, the second row for email and url should have "'"? 3. For Portuguese, the second row for email and url should have "ç"? Note: The patch was update by preserving this keys at email and url input type.
Flags: needinfo?(ofeng)
(In reply to Raniere Silva from comment #6) > Some questions, although they are very similar. > 1. For Spanish, the second row for email and url should have "ñ"? > 2. For Catalan, Croatian, Hungarian and Serbian, the second row for email > and url should have "'"? > 3. For Portuguese, the second row for email and url should have "ç"? Yes to all three questions. "ñ", "'" and "ç" are valid (or limited supported) in URL and email address, so we should keep them.
Flags: needinfo?(ofeng)
Hi Jan, could you review the patch again? It should fix this issue for all layouts now.
Flags: needinfo?(janjongboom)
Attachment #8435773 - Flags: review?(janjongboom)
Flags: needinfo?(janjongboom)
Comment on attachment 8435773 [details] [review] patch-remove-extra-keys-from-second-row r=me. Looks good. Thanks!
Attachment #8435773 - Flags: review?(janjongboom) → review+
Jan, could you merge this?
Flags: needinfo?(janjongboom)
It's a major issue in new feature. Nominating as 2.0 blocking. A consistent layout is really important for a large number of users.
blocking-b2g: --- → 2.0?
I discussed this bug (and others like it) with Jason in IRC today. This looks like a 2.0 feature that was not correctly or fully implemented to spec, and should not ship as-is as a result (per Omega's comment #13). To that end, I am removing the blocking flag but adding the feature-b2g flag for 2.0, which it looks like this bug should have had as it was on the work list for 2.0. If this is not correct, let me know and we can discuss making it a blocking bug if it was not indeed a feature. I am not sure why the attachment has ui-review+ if the UI is not correct. When there is a major issue like this with a patch, the patch should get ui-review- and only get a ui-review+ when the submitted patch is 100% correct and ready to ship. Omega, please update the ui-review flags based on your understanding of this issue. Thank you! Omega and Carol, please work on the necessary ui-review flag issues here. Thanks!
blocking-b2g: 2.0? → ---
feature-b2g: --- → 2.0
Flags: needinfo?(ofeng)
Hi Steph, Sorry for misleading. (Maybe I used the wrong flagging I guess.) The patch is ui-review+. Since it's already done and ui-review+/review+, I hope it can be landed on 2.0 if there is low risk.
Flags: needinfo?(ofeng)
No problem, Omega! I just want to be sure everything is actually OK to ship. Rudy, since this is OK to land (if it is), can you mark this approval?/+ or should it just ride the train to release?
Flags: needinfo?(rlu)
For me, I would prefer to make this change into the next release, though the patch here may look like a low-risk one. This is because we modify some of the layouts but not all of them, so I would like to see more testers/users, especially l10n communities, take a look at these changes. I think this would take some time and if we make this change into v2.0 in a rush, I'm afraid there will no time to make any changes if there is any potential issue. Please let me know if you don't agree. Thanks.
Flags: needinfo?(rlu)
Rudy, that sounds like a good risk assessment. Omega, what will the keyboard look like if it ships? Will it be acceptable or no? If it will be a poor experience, is there something else we could do? Please advise and thank you!
Flags: needinfo?(ofeng)
It's fine not to land on 2.0. I'll review all other related layouts and write them down in the UX spec, so that we can have a reference for the next release (2.1).
Flags: needinfo?(ofeng)
This is not committed in 2.0, removing feature-b2g tag.
feature-b2g: 2.0 → ---
This has landed, see Comment 12.
Assignee: nobody → ra092767
Status: NEW → RESOLVED
Closed: 11 years ago
Resolution: --- → FIXED
Priority: -- → P1
Could you provide a video for me to verify this bug? Thanks.
Flags: needinfo?(ofeng)
Attached video verify_video.MP4
This issue has been verified successfully on Flame v2.1 STR: 1. Launch E-Mail app. 2. New a mail. 3. Tap any email input box to show keyboard. **There is no '_' key in the second row. See attachment: verify_video.MP4 Reproducing rate: 0/5 Flame 2.1 versions: Gaia-Rev dbaf3e31c9ba9c3436e074381744f2971e15c7bf Gecko-Rev https://hg.mozilla.org/releases/mozilla-b2g34_v2_1/rev/ebce587d2194 Build-ID 20141203001205 Version 34.0 Device-Name flame FW-Release 4.4.2 FW-Incremental eng.cltbld.20141203.034907 FW-Date Wed Dec 3 03:49:18 EST 2014 Bootloader L1TC00011880
Status: RESOLVED → VERIFIED
Sue, thanks for your verification!
Flags: needinfo?(ofeng)
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: